#25-41 Doe v. Santa Cruz-Monterey-Merced Managed Medical Care Commission, S288552. (H051515; nonpublished opinion; Santa Cruz County Superior Court; 20CV02149.) Petition for review after the Court of Appeal affirmed the judgment in a civil action. The court ordered briefing deferred pending decision in J.M. v. Illuminate Education, Inc., S286699 (#24-211), which presents the following issue: Is a company that stores students’ confidential personal and medical information through its work providing software to school districts subject to liability to these students under the Confidentiality of Medical Information Act (Civ. Code, § 56 et seq.) and the Customer Records Act (Civ. Code, § 1798.80 et seq.) following disclosure of such information through a data breach?
Petition for review granted; briefing deferred: 2/11/2025
